Output e4cbaa9e2839407953f56d3a8b9a5edda120bb634d867807ba9bb958e62677c8:1

value
10706931
script pubkey
OP_0 OP_PUSHBYTES_20 d03bd38145e595c11031a6abf13b77c15f9897dd
address
bc1q6qaa8q29uk2uzyp3564lzwmhc90e397a36ya6j
transaction
e4cbaa9e2839407953f56d3a8b9a5edda120bb634d867807ba9bb958e62677c8
spent
true